Shenzhen Dapeng Peninsula National Geopark Museum, Eastern Coastal Plank Road, Dafen Oil Painting Village, Shenzhen Bay Park, Dujuan Mountain, etc. are all fun things to do in Shenzhen places, and they’re all free. Please refer to the following for details.

1. Shenzhen Bay Park is the waterfront leisure landscape of Shenzhen Bay Community. The Shenzhen Branch of the China Urban Planning and Design Institute and the American SWA Group completed the preliminary overall planning, and jointly completed the planning and design of the project implementation with the Shenzhen Bei Yuanlin Landscape and Architectural Planning and Design Institute.

2. Dujuan Mountain is located behind the South Library of Shenzhen University, facing the south gate in front. On the right is Wenshan Lake and Wenshan Lake Dormitory of Shenzhen University, and on the left is Shenzhen University’s Stone Pier and students Activity Center. This was originally a wasteland. In the summer vacation of 2013, Shenzhen University developed Dujuan Mountain and built plank roads around it. When you stand on Dujuan Mountain and take a closer look, Blue Bay merges with other parks, with overlapping scenery and distinct layers. This is a great place to travel.

3. Dafen Oil Painting Village was originally an inconspicuous Hakka village located in Buji Street, Shenzhen, with more than 350 original residents. In 1989, Hong Kong painter Huang Jiang came to Dafen, rented a house, recruited students and painters, and created, copied, collected and resold oil paintings in batches, thus bringing the special industry of oil painting into Dafen Village. Later, Dafen oil paintings became a well-known cultural brand at home and abroad.

4. The eastern coastal plank road passes through Minsk Aircraft Carrier, Dameisha, and Xiaomeisha. It is a favorite for hiking parties, with few people and beautiful scenery. But it should be noted that this is not a complete plank road, but consists of many sections. The best sections are the section in front of Dameisha and the section behind Xiaomeisha, which takes about 5 hours to walk.

Shenzhen Dapeng Peninsula National Geopark Museum is located in the south-central part of Dapeng Peninsula in eastern Shenzhen, about 50 kilometers away from Shenzhen city, with a total area of ??150 square kilometers and a forest coverage rate of 98%. It belongs to the south subtropical maritime monsoon climate. The Dapeng Peninsula, where Shenzhen Dapeng Peninsula National Geopark is located, borders Daya Bay to the east, Huizhou to the west, Dapeng Bay to the west, and the South China Sea to the south. The shortest distance between Ping Chau in Hong Kong is 3.704 kilometers. In 2005, the Ministry of Land and Resources officially approved the establishment of the Shenzhen Dapeng Peninsula National Geopark.

Shenzhen is located in the central and southern coastal areas of Guangdong Province, north to the east of the Pearl River Estuary, with a low latitude and a subtropical oceanic climate. Affected by the monsoon, southeasterly winds prevail in summer, the monsoon pressure is low, tropical cyclones visit, and the weather is hot and rainy. In other seasons, the northeast monsoon prevails, the weather is relatively dry and the climate is mild. The winter temperature in Shenzhen is between 19-22 degrees.

1. Let's talk about Shenzhen summer. The hottest months in Shenzhen are July and August every year, with an average maximum temperature of 31 degrees Celsius, an average minimum temperature of 27 degrees Celsius, an extreme maximum temperature of 39 degrees Celsius, and an extreme minimum temperature of 21 degrees Celsius.

2. In winter, the coldest month in Shenzhen is January every year, with an average maximum temperature of 19 degrees Celsius, an average minimum temperature of 14 degrees Celsius, an extreme maximum temperature of 27 degrees Celsius, and an extreme minimum temperature of 3 degrees Celsius.

3. Most of the weather (March to November) is hot. In terms of clothing, short shirts are mostly worn for the weather. From December to February, you can basically wear single clothes on sunny days, add a jacket on rainy days, and add a sweater on extremely low temperatures.
